A leaked audio recording of Fuji music superstar King Wasiu Ayinde Marshal, also known as Kwam 1, has been released, providing a full account of the tense event involving ValueJet Airline at Nnamdi Azikiwe International Airport, Abuja.

The recording, which captures Kwam 1's voice recounting his confrontation with ValueJet employees, has sparked a new public debate and polarised opinions on social media.

In the recording, Kwam 1 claimed that he wasn’t feeling well and needed to bring a flask of water on board due to a medical issue.

He recalled his interaction with airline authorities, citing unfair treatment and detailing how the incident developed when he was denied boarding the flight.

“I am a patient. I needed this water every second,” he said.

Kwam 1 talked about how he embarrassed himself by spilling the contents of the flask down a ValueJet employee's face, claiming it was water.

In addition to expressing annoyance at being refused boarding, KWAM 1 subtly warned the airline's leadership about the ValueJet owner's business ties. Soname will sense my presence.

Kwam 1 said: "Soname will feel me. He will feel me in his business," highlighting the intensity of the conflict with ValueJet's owner, Kunle Soname, who also runs Bet9ja.

The recording also heard KWAM1 discussing his recent surgery and ongoing health difficulties as backdrop for his conduct.

Despite the incident, he insisted that he did not intend to cause trouble, but rather felt embarrassed by the airline's handling of the situation.

KWAM 1 denies any wrongdoing

Legit.ng earlier reported that KWAM 1 spoke out following accusations of misconduct during a boarding process for a ValueJet flight.

In a statement, the veteran performer insisted that, contrary to media reports, he was the victim, not the aggressor, in the now-public incident.

According to Kwam 1’s camp, it turned out to be nothing more than plain drinking water handed to him while at the lounge. His media aide, Kunle Rasheed, said in a statement: “Despite his respectful effort to clarify this, the situation was unnecessarily escalated.”
